Common Signs You Might Have Mold or Poor Indoor Air Quality

Many Stafford Township residents seek professional mold inspections because of suspicious signs in their homes or businesses, such as:

• Musty or damp odors that linger
• Visible black, green, or white spots on walls, ceilings, or vents
• Persistent allergy or asthma symptoms that worsen indoors
• Water leaks or history of flooding
• Increased humidity or condensation on windows

Mold can hide behind walls, under flooring, and inside ductwork, making it hard to spot without professional testing.

Health Concerns Linked to Untreated Mold Growth

Ignoring mold problems can have serious consequences for your well-being. Some of the most common health effects include:

• Chronic coughing, sneezing, and respiratory irritation
• Headaches and fatigue
• Skin rashes and eye irritation
• Worsening asthma and allergy symptoms
• In severe cases, long-term exposure can lead to more serious respiratory illnesses

Individuals with weakened immune systems, young children, and the elderly are especially vulnerable to mold-related health risks.

How Professional Mold Testing Identifies Hidden Problems

If you suspect mold or poor air quality but aren’t sure, professional testing is your best next step. Nash Everett uses advanced methods to assess your indoor environment, including:

• Air sampling to detect invisible airborne spores
• Surface sampling for visible growths
• Moisture mapping to find hidden water intrusion sources
• Thermal imaging to spot unseen mold-friendly conditions behind walls

Testing gives you a clear picture of what’s happening inside your property, so we can recommend the right solutions.

What Happens During Professional Mold Removal

If mold is detected in your Stafford Township property, Nash Everett’s certified team follows a detailed, safe, and effective remediation process:

• Isolating the affected areas to prevent mold spread
• Using HEPA air filtration and containment systems
• Removing contaminated materials safely and thoroughly
• Cleaning and sanitizing affected surfaces with specialized agents
• Addressing moisture problems to prevent mold from returning

Our goal is not just to remove the mold you see but to address the root causes that allowed it to grow in the first place.
